Ajout de lignes dans tableau et modification des formules

Bonjour à tous,

L'intitulé du sujet n'est pas très parlant, mais je vais tenter de vous expliquer la suite ici. Dans le domaine des achats (marchés publics), je souhaite établir un document type pour analyser des réponses d'entreprises (pour des personnes qui ont peu de mal avec l'Excel de base...). Bien entendu, en fonction de l'achat, il n'y a pas toujours le même nombre d'entreprises qui répondent. Du coup, j'ai créé un fichier avec deux onglets :

  • le premier pour renseigner le nombre d'entreprises et le contenu de leur offre (une sorte de tableau de synthèse) ;
  • le second pour procéder à l'analyse technique des offres.
J'ai pas mal avancé en créant une macro qui me permet d'ajouter une nouvelle entreprise sur chaque onglet (et j'en suis fier ! ), avec numérotation automatique et reprise des formules. Mais je bloque sur quelques points (peut-être simples, mais pas trouvé !) :
  • Comment faire en sorte que la nouvelle ligne soit créée seulement sur les onglets "PV" et "analyse", mais pas sur l'onglet "échelle de notation" ?
  • Comment puis-je faire en sorte que les formules inscrites dans l'onglet "analyse" se mettent à jour (en quelque sorte), notamment en D8 et M12 ? Car en créant une nouvelle ligne, la formule ne reprend pas la totalité des lignes (je ne suis pas clair, mais quand vous regarderez le tableau, ça devrait l'être un peu plus !).

Merci d'avance à toutes les réponses et bonne soirée.

Salut Steffcci,

pas spécialiste en Excel pur mais ça a l'air pas mal! A tester!

Tu dois quand même encoder le montant de l'offre dans 'PV' [Fxx] après ajout d'une ligne pour que cette valeur soit reprise en 'Synthèse' et permettre le calcul.

A+

18analyseoffres.xlsm (26.70 Ko)
curulis57 a écrit :

Salut Steffcci,

pas spécialiste en Excel pur mais ça a l'air pas mal! A tester!

Tu dois quand même encoder le montant de l'offre dans 'PV' [Fxx] après ajout d'une ligne pour que cette valeur soit reprise en 'Synthèse' et permettre le calcul.

A+

Salut Curulis57,

Comme tu le précises d'emblée, c'est en fait un problème d'Excel pur et non de VBA... Je n'ai donc pas posté au bon endroit ! lol

Mais sinon je te remercie beaucoup de ton aide, car c'était effectivement tout simple, il n'y avait qu'à tirer la formule à + 1000 !

Comme quoi j'ai bien fait de poster quand même !

Encore merci à toi ! Je mets en résolu.

Rechercher des sujets similaires à "ajout lignes tableau modification formules"